I'll start with an anti-focus and pick two teams that don't deserve to win the Super Bowl.

Arizona - This is a team that managed to make its way into the playoffs despite scoring only one more point than they allowed over the course of the regular season. On the whole, they were slightly above mediocre, as their 9-7 record would suggest. They're a team that benefited from playing in the sorriest division in the NFL. If you continue to follow this logic, you'll have no problem guessing which team comes next.

San Diego - A team with as much talent as any team in the league, the Chargers backed into the playoffs with an 8-8 record by virtue of playing in an equally bad division as did the Cardinals. Color me unimpressed.

Once my team has been eliminated from the post-season, I generally root for the teams that I think are best to win the championship - because I feel that they "deserve" it. While there's not a better alternative, the current playoff structure in the NFL isn't very good at selecting the best team as the eventual champion.

Eliminating those two teams leaves Pittsburgh, Baltimore, and Philadelphia in play. On the surface you could argue the Eagles, with a 9-6-1 record, belong in the above group, but given their point differential (+127 - good for 4th in the league), I think their record is more a result of bad breaks and playing in a good division than anything else. Pittsburgh is one of the most well run franchises in all of sports and Baltimore was solid all year long. I'd say all three of those teams are "deserving" of a Super Bowl title.
